Understanding the Thread Rolling Machine and Its HSN Code


Thread rolling machines are essential tools in the manufacturing and metalworking industries, primarily used to create threads on fasteners such as bolts, screws, and other components. These machines utilize a process known as cold forming, which offers significant advantages over traditional machining methods. Understanding thread rolling machines, their working principles, applications, and the associated Harmonized System Nomenclature (HSN) codes is crucial for manufacturers and suppliers in the industry.


What is a Thread Rolling Machine?


A thread rolling machine employs a unique technique to form threads using metal deformation rather than cutting. The process involves placing a cylindrical workpiece between two patterned rolling dies. As the dies rotate and move toward the workpiece, they exert pressure, causing the material to flow and form threads. This method is highly efficient and produces strong, precise threads with excellent surface finish.


Advantages of Thread Rolling


1. Increased Strength The cold working process enhances the mechanical properties of the material, resulting in stronger threads without compromising ductility. 2. Reduced Waste Unlike cutting processes that remove material, thread rolling shapes the material without significant waste, making it a cost-effective option.


3. Enhanced Surface Finish The non-cutting process yields smoother surfaces, reducing the need for additional finishing operations.


4. High Production Rates Thread rolling machines can produce a large volume of threaded components quickly, making them ideal for high-demand manufacturing environments.


5. Versatility These machines can work with various materials, including steel, aluminum, brass, and other metals, making them suitable for various applications.

HSN Code for Thread Rolling Machines


In international trade, products and machinery are classified using the Harmonized System (HS) codes. These codes facilitate the systematic categorization of goods and aid in customs procedures, ensuring proper tariffs and classifications are applied.


Thread rolling machines generally fall under the machinery section of the HSN codes. The specific code for thread rolling machines can often be found in the subcategories related to machine tools for shaping metal. The HSN code can vary by region or country, but it typically begins with the digits corresponding to machinery. Manufacturers and suppliers must verify the correct HSN codes for their products in their specific markets to comply with regulations and trade requirements.
